The Truth about Lie Detector Tests and Judge Judy:

In an article by the syndicated columnist L.M. BOYD shortly after the
year 1983, "If you're truly innocent, never take a lie detector test. But
if you are guilty, take one - you might be exonerated. So advises a
polygraph expert. The test reads bodily reactions that oftentimes have
nothing to do with truth or falsehood. Says this authority: You can hang
yourself in the mind of the machine's interpreter just because you're
nervous."
